  • Integrating ELA and CNN for Image Manipulation Detection
    M.R. Senkumar, C. Priya, S.M.Haji Nishath, I.Sheik Arafat, R. Premkumar, S. Karthiyayini
    Proceedings of the 6th International Conference on Smart Electronics and Communication Icosec 2025, 2025
    In the era of digital media, image manipulation poses significant threats to authenticity and trust across domains such as journalism, law enforcement, and social media. This study introduces an innovative approach for detecting tampered images through the integration of Error Level Analysis (ELA) and Convolutional Neural Networks (CNNs) utilising deep learning techniques. ELA preprocessing enhances detection by revealing compression inconsistencies, enabling the CNN to learn tampering-specific patterns. The model underwent training and validation utilising the CASIA1 dataset, achieving strong performance in accuracy, precision, and recall. Compared to traditional architectures like ResNet and VGG-16, the custom CNN integrated with ELA demonstrated superior results in detecting subtle manipulations. While the method shows high reliability, limitations include its binary classification nature and dependence on dataset diversity. Future work will explore multi-class classification and localization. Overall, this approach highlights the potential of blending traditional digital forensic techniques with modern deep learning methods to improve image forgery detection.
  • Design and Implementation of the Distributed Dosimetric System Based on the Principles of IoT
    C. Priya
    Next Generation Innovation in Iot and Cloud Computing with Applications, 2024
    This chapter describes the architecture and components of the distributed information and management system for collecting, processing, storing, and distributing data on a radiometric and dosimetric experiment using the principle of the Internet of Things. Data exchange between elements in the system, as well as the analysis of the received information, involves active application of the ThingSpeak cloud service. Two-way communication with the cloud with a 15-second loop has been implemented. Data are processed in the MATLAB (America) environment, integrated into the cloud. The developed hardware and software solutions demonstrate an increased accuracy of measurements due to the use of promising cadmium telluride (CdZnTe) detectors, modern microcontroller and micro communication technology, and a new algorithm for correcting the dependence of detector sensitivity on radiation energy. Measurement with correction by the method of average charge pulse amplitude is carried out in the energy range of 60 keV to 3 MeV. The resolution of the spectrometric channel is 6.5% at the peak of 662 keV of full absorption from the reference source, cesium (Сs-137). The module for a laboratory sensor network, designed to measure the dose of ionizing radiation, has a built-in spectrometric analog–digital converter, microcontroller control, and a communication unit. Constructing the diagrams demonstrates the operation of the interrupt handler in the form of a series of events occurring when requests arrive from a web server. The peculiarity of the system is the absence of intermediate devices that make it possible to establish a connection with the Internet. The developed system, equipment, algorithms, and programs are used for experimental studies of radiation and nuclear-physical processes. Elements of the system were useful for remote laboratory work by students.

  • Deep Fuzzy Clustering and Deep Residual Network for Prediction of Web Pages from Weblog Data with Fractional Order Based Ranking
    P. G. Om Prakash, K. Suresh Kumar, Balajee Maram, C. Priya
    International Journal of Uncertainty Fuzziness and Knowledge Based Systems, 2023
    Web page recommendation system has attracted more attention in recent decades. The web page recommendation has various characteristics than the classical recommenders. It is the process of predicting the request of the next web page that users are significantly interested while searching the web. It helps the users to find relevant pages in the field of web mining. In particular, web user may spend more time to identify expected information. To understand behavior of users and to visit the page based on their interest at a specific time, an effective web page recommendation method is developed by developed Multi-Verse Sailfish Optimization (MVSFO)-based Deep Residual network. Accordingly, proposed MVSFO is derived by the integration of Multi-Verse Optimizer (MVO) and Sailfish Optimizer (SFO), respectively. Here, the process of recommendation is carried out using weblog data and the web page image. The sequential patterns are acquired from weblog data, and the patterns are grouped with Deep fuzzy clustering based on cosine similarity. The matching process among test pattern and sequential patterns are made using Canberra distance. Here, the recommended web pages obtained from the weblog data and pages obtained from web pages image using the Deep Residual network are enable to generate the output using fractional order-based ranking. The developed scheme attained more effectiveness by the measures, such as F-measure, precision, and recall as 85.30%, 86.59%, and 86.04%, respectively for MSNBC dataset.

  • ECG Monitoring System using IoT for Health Care Applications
    K. Vijaipriya, C. Priya, Siji Sivanandan, R. Krishnaswamy
    Proceedings of the 2023 2nd International Conference on Augmented Intelligence and Sustainable Systems Icaiss 2023, 2023
    The ECG monitoring system is an innovative method of heart health monitoring that makes use of the Internet of Things for healthcare purposes. With the use of Raspberry Pi, an electrocardiogram (ECG) sensor, and a cloud server, this system can monitor a patient's heart rate in real time and indefinitely, which has several benefits for both the patient and the doctor. Using the IoT, the ECG sensor can communicate to the cloud storage directly. The patient's electrical heart activity is monitored by use of an ECG sensor. After that, the sensor's output data is sent to the cloud server through Raspberry Pi, which operates as a connection between the sensor and the cloud server. Analyzing and evaluating ECG data in real time through cloud servers using advanced methods. The approaches are sensitive and accurate sufficient to detect cardiac irregularities such arrhythmias. When anomalies are detected, the system immediately generates realtime alerts to healthcare professionals. Instant alerts allow for prompt medical treatment, which improves patient outcomes and decreases the potential of catastrophic events. The cloud server provides a store for patient data and will enable doctors to access it from anywhere. In healthcare settings, this system's ability to identify cardiac problems early improves patient care and promotes preventative approaches to controlling heart health.
  • Smart IoT Solutions for Personalized Health: MQTT- Based Blood Pressure Monitoring System
    Pradeepa H, C. Priya, Saravanan G, R. Thenmozhi, C. Srinivasan
    7th International Conference on Electronics Communication and Aerospace Technology Iceca 2023 Proceedings, 2023
    Healthcare awareness can be achieved via remote monitoring of vital signs using Internet of Things (IoT) technology. The proposed system aims to monitor blood pressure and other important signs with the help of the MQTT (Message Queuing Telemetry Transport) protocol. The main objective of the blood pressure monitor is to increase health awareness through real-time warnings for high and low blood pressure. The device has sensors that can measure blood pressure quickly and accurately. Using IoT technology, the monitor may send this information wirelessly to a central server where it can be processed and analyzed. MQTT is the protocol for two-way communication between the blood pressure monitor and the main server. When a measurement is taken, it is compared to a set of medically recognized and individually adjusted threshold values to determine whether or not an individual has high or low blood pressure. IoT devices get notifications whenever blood pressure measurements exceed predetermined limits. After receiving these notifications, a device can communicate them to the user interface, such as a web application. This wireless IoT blood-pressure monitor improves health awareness by warning users of unhealthy blood pressure levels. Alerts allow users to contact medical help, modify medication, or adapt their lifestyle to maintain ideal blood pressure.
